小程序父子组件通信传值、父组件调取子组件、子组件调取父组件
父组件中default-value为传递给子组件的值x-picker-dateid=&picker-date&default-value=&{{newTime}}&wx:if=&{{showPicker}}&bind:myevent=&toggleToast&/x-picker-date父组件jsshowPickerDate(e){
微信小程序 父组件调用子组件方法
小程序学习之旅slot子组件调用父组件的方法、父组件调用子组件的方法
slot子组件!--pages/user/user.wxml--headertitle={{title}}/header{{title}}footerbutton我是footer子组件里的按钮/button/footer在footer子组件里slot调用
微信小程序 父组件调用子组件方法
微信小程序父组件调用子组件方法
假如我们已经有了一个自定义组件toast组件里面有个方法控制toast的显示假如我要在登录界面引用toast,那如何调用自定义组件的方法控制toast显示?1.首先在登录的json页面引用组件2.在登录的wxml页面引用组件(一定要设置id)3.在登录页的js页面的生命周期中获取组件(图中的传入的参数就是第2步设置的组
微信小程序 父组件调用子组件方法
微信小程序子组件调用父组件方法
原文连接---https://blog.csdn.net/qq_40190624/article/details/87972265组件js:varvalue=123;this.triggerEvent(callSomeFun,value)父组件wxml:componentbind:callSo
微信小程序 父组件调用子组件方法
小程序父组件触发子组件方法
小程序中有一个横向导航菜单,点击不同选项去加载不同的自定义组件,有些菜单选项所对应的组件是相同的,这时候发现点击这些选项进行切换的时候数据并没有发生变化。原因:因为组件在上一次已经加载完成了,而组件中数据初始化操作(initData方法)是放在ready中的,所以并不会触发初始化解决:小程序官方文档中,生成的组件实例包含一些属性和方法,可以用selectComponent方法选中组件实例
微信小程序 父组件调用子组件方法
微信小程序——父子组件传参以及方法的调用
父组件向子组件传参A组件为父组件,B组件为子组件,以下是A组件向B组件传参在A组件中引入B组件(父组件引入子组件)在A组件的json中写入(父组件):{&component&:true,&usingComponents&:{&componentB&:&../child/child&}}在A组件的wxml中写入(父组件):
微信小程序 父组件调用子组件方法
微信小程序父子组件方法调用
创建组件鼠标右键选择新建component注意js和json文件,详细介绍请看文档(https://developers.weixin.qq.com/miniprogram/dev/framework/custom-component/wxml-wxss.html)。如果在子组件中使用全局样式(app.wxss),那么需要在子组件的wxss中引入app.wxss:@import
微信小程序 父组件调用子组件方法
微信小程序实现仿微信聊天界面(各种细节处理)
话不多说,美图镇楼:下面先来看看效果为实现这样的效果,首先要解决两个问题:1.点击输入框弹出软键盘后,将已有的少许聊天内容弹出,导致看不到的问题;2.键盘弹出或收起时,聊天消息没有自动滚到最底部。首先解决第二个问题,自动滚动到最底部,这很简单,这里提供三种方法(推荐第三种):1.计算每条消息的最大高度,设置scrolltop=(单条msg最大高度*msg条数)px。2.用将...
微信小程序 微信聊天内容恢复